Day One: Geological Fundamentals for Mining
- Basic geological concepts and their significance in mining
- Understanding rock types and mineral properties
- Geophysical methods in mineral exploration
- Geological mapping for mining engineers
- Introduction to structural geology
- Hands-on exercise: Identifying geological features
Day Two: Tools and Techniques for Geological Analysis
- Data collection methods in mining geology
- Integrating geological data into mining models
- Techniques for resource estimation
- Practical session: Analyzing geological data
- Group discussion: Overcoming common challenges
Day Three: Blast Design and Optimization
- Principles of blasting in mining operations
- Designing safe and efficient blast patterns
- Evaluating blast performance using geological data
- Case study: Optimizing blasting for sustainability
Day Four: Sustainability in Mining Operations
- Environmental impacts of mining and mitigation strategies
- Sustainable mining practices and technologies
- Applying geology to reduce waste and improve efficiency
- Regulatory compliance and reporting requirements
- Group activity: Developing a sustainability plan
- Interactive discussion: Case studies of sustainable mining
Day Five: Integration and Practical Application
- Comprehensive review of geological concepts
- Creating integrated mining plans
- Group presentations: Solutions to real-world scenarios
- Strategies for continuous improvement
